Arahama
Arahama is a quarter in Watari Chō, Watari district, Miyagi. Arahama is situated nearby to the quarter Okuma-Warabi, as well as near the neighborhood 字鳥屋崎.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Watari
Town
Photo: Kuha455405,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Watari is a town located in Miyagi Prefecture, Japan. As of 31 March 2020, the town had an estimated population of 33,459, and a population density of 450 persons per km2 in 12,643 households. The total area of the town is 73.60 square kilometres. Watari is situated 3 km west of Arahama.
